1550nm 10KW Powerful Pulse Nanosecond Ultra-fast Fiber Laser Source Benchtop HP-NSFL-A-1550-1/200-10-1/1000-SM-FA-B

The high power nanosecond pulse fiber laser uses a high-power gain fiber module and cooperates with a dedicated drive and temperature control circuit to output high-peak and high-energy laser pulses. The laser wavelength and power are stable, RS232 serial port remote control, modular design facilitates system integration, and can be used for laser radar, distributed optical fiber sensing systems, etc.

[Features]
Full fiber structure.
Pulse width, repetition frequency, and power can be adjusted.
Pulse energy up to 100uJ.

[Applications]
Lidar
Nonlinear optics
Distributed Fiber Optic Sensing

Note-Trigger:
Trigger Method - External trigger: If it is an external trigger, it means that the customer needs to input a periodic clock signal to the laser source to trigger the laser light source from the outside in order to output a nanosecond periodic pulse signal.
